Named the "father of Bossa Nova", Antonio Carlos (Tom) Jobim is considered one of the greatest composers of his time. It was in the 1960s that he internationalized a new sound, very popular in Brazil, combining jazz harmonies with bossa nova. The singer Elis Regina, unique in her kind, is to Brazilian music what Ella Fitzgerald is to Jazz. With stellar compositions such as "Aguas de março", "Triste", "Corcovado", "Fotografia"..., sensual, unbridled and timeless musicality, the Elis/Tom duo has become legendary.Passionate about Jazz and Brazilian music since young age (and mentored by the most regretted Marcia Maria), vocalist Pascale ELIA forms the group “JaBraZz” in 2021 from her complicity with Brazilian guitarist Victor DA COSTA. About Vincent Thekal:
« Few tenors in the 21st century have captured the expanse between beauty and complexity quite like Thekal« : when Ron Hart reviewed Brussels-based Vincent Thekal‘s latest trio record in DownBeat Magazine, the critically acclaimed ‘Origami’ (Hypnote, 2018), he expressed what many listeners have been experiencing listening to his impressive musicality.
His new album, « Monk’s Mood » (Hypnote 2023), with major europeans musicians, already impresses with its rereading of Thelonious Monk’s repertoire.
In addition Vincent has played with Bob Mover, Jerome Sabbagh, David Bryant, Franck Agulhon, Dre Pallemaerts, Bo Van Der Werf, Fabian Fiorini and Jean Louis Rassinfosse among other.
He has appeared in numerous jazz clubs and festivals throughout Europe, including Jazz à Vienne, Nancy Jazz Pulsations, Millau en Jazz, Dinant Jazz Night, Brussels Jazz Marathon, Blues’n’jazz Rally and Jazz im Brunnenhof to name a few, including U.S.A., France, Belgium, Netherlands, Germany, Luxembourg, UK, Finland, Switzerland, Algeria….

The music of Wayne Shorter is extremely versatile. From being the artistic director of Art Blakey and the jazz messengers to being the main composer for the second great Miles Davis quintet. After that there where numerous different groups where he transcended musical genres and pushed the limits of what was possible.
Wenya in Orbit is a tribute to Wayne Shorter, with the focus lying on his compositions during his period with Miles Davis and his blue note albums like “Juju”, “Speak no Evil”. There is also emphasis on his great quartet with Brian Blade, Danillo Perez and John Pattituci. Through his music and some of our own compositions we try to achieve “zero Gravity”.

The “Tribute to Jackie McLean” project was born within the walls of the Royal Conservatory of Brussels.
The McLean sextet explores a repertoire signed by the American saxophonist who was very active in the 1950s/60s.
This repertoire includes mostly compositions of modal music but also hard-bop standards.
In search of sound radiation, the members of the sextet play with colors and unite in a musical and human symbiosis.

The Music Village Rue des Pierres 50 Steenstraat, BrusselsThis year is the ninth year of the Jazz Vocal course at Brussels Royal Conservatoire.
With just four singers at the start ‘Chant Jazz’ at CRB is now firmly established - with a community of between ten and twelve singers enrolled at any one time.
Under the guidance of Pete Churchill these singers are fast becoming a positive force on the Brussels Jazz scene and tonight is a chance to hear these Jazz Singers of tomorrow in the intimate surroundings of one of the great Jazz Clubs of Europe. They will be accompanied by the Pete Churchill Trio.
Pete Churchill
In a long international career as a pianist, singer, choral director and conductor, Pete Churchill was, for fifteen years, accompanist to the great Mark Murphy with further collaborations over the years with Jon Hendricks, Sheila Jordan, Norma Winstone, Kenny Wheeler, Abdullah Ibrahim and many more.

"Standard Deviation" is a duo of two friends that wants to find different paths of expression in the so noble, and as well challenging, art of playing standards.
In Jazz, "Standard" is a composition that is part of the musical repertoire of jazz musicians; a very much known, performed, and recorded material by jazz musicians, as well as known by jazz listeners.
Getting rid of the classic trio (or more) formation, the duo forces himself to go out out of the canonic ways to play this repertoire.
The arrangemets infact are made and thought for a formation that has deficit in low frequencies, since is missing the ground that the bass usually provides.
From here rise a variation in the research, just like a Standard Deviation in Statistics: a measure of the amount of variation of a set of values.
Original songs are also part of the duo's repertoire.
